India's GDP per capita, PPP reached an all-time high of 11,748 Int$/person in 2025, advancing from 10,719 in 2024. The series, starting in 1990, has seen a tenfold increase from its low of 1,177 Int$/person. The latest value also marks the highest recorded level.

About this series
GDP per Capita PPP in India averaged $4,231 international dollars from 1990 until 2025, reaching an all-time high of $11,748 international dollars in Dec 2025 and a record low of $1,177 international dollars in Dec 1990. The series is reported yearly with history from 1990.
GDP per capita, PPP measures the total economic output of India adjusted for purchasing power parity, divided by the mid-year population. It is expressed in international dollars per person, reported annually. The series spans from 1990 to the present, providing a long-term perspective on living standards.
